Omega-7 supports healthy skin, lipid balance, and inflammation control while promoting heart and metabolic wellness.
Derived from sea buckthorn or macadamia oil, Omega-7 (palmitoleic acid) aids lipid metabolism and skin barrier repair. It helps reduce dryness, supports insulin sensitivity, and enhances heart and mucosal health. For seniors, it promotes radiant skin and metabolic balance.

Daily intake of sea buckthorn oil improved vaginal health in postmenopausal women, offering a potential alternative to estrogen therapy.
Taking palmitoleic acid supplements significantly improved skin hydration and elasticity over 12 weeks in women aged 42-59.
